    i clicked my ad by mistake once, so i emailed google, fearing well you know adsense has the tendency to "ban now, talk later policy". they replied

    Thanks for letting us know about the accidental click on your ads. We appreciate your honesty and your continued efforts toward avoiding such
    clicks going forward.

    haha, publisher live everyday in fear of being ban for no reason ... thats why i'm applying to YPN as backup. i tried adbrite, nah not as good as adsense

    so try not to click ur ads if you cherish it :)
